Ratio Decidendi

The Court allowed the withdrawal of the appeal against the conviction on two counts of robbery, as requested by the appellants. The Court clarified that the withdrawal does not affect the appellant's right to pursue an appeal against the conviction for attempted rape, which was not the subject of the current proceedings. The decision was based on the procedural right of an appellant to withdraw an appeal and the principle that such withdrawal does not bar subsequent appeals on other convictions arising from the same or related proceedings.

Court Disposition

Appeal marked as withdrawn.

Orders

  • The appeal against conviction on two counts of robbery is marked withdrawn.
  • The appellant is at liberty to appeal against his conviction for attempted rape.
